Reid and Riege, P.C., a mid-sized Connecticut law firm with well-established health and human services and business services practices, seeks a health care/corporate attorney with at least
3 years
of experience to join our team in the downtown Hartford office. Partial remote work will be considered.
Qualified candidates will have demonstrated experience with counseling health care and human service organizations, and a defined vision of their role as a legal advisor. Portable business is a plus, but not a requirement, even for more senior candidates.
The successful candidate will possess strong organizational, research, and communication skills, an aggressive work ethic, and excellent judgment. Knowledge on Stark Law, Anti-Kickback Statue, HIPPAA and False Claims Act is a plus. We offer significant opportunity for career advancement in a friendly and professional environment, an excellent benefits package, and compensation commensurate with level of experience.
Reid and Riege is an equal opportunity employer dedicated to workforce diversity.
Juris Doctor (JD) from an accredited law school CT Bar
admission in good standing or ability to become admitted promptly 3+ years
of experience in healthcare law, corporate transactions, or a combination thereof Strong legal writing, analytical, and client-communication skills Exceptional writing ability, regulatory research skills
Benefits Health, Dental, & Vision insurance Life insurance, disability insurance and EAP coverage PTO, Paid Holidays, Sick Time, Bereavement and Parental leave 401(k) plan with employer contributions (Traditional and Roth options available) Competitive compensation commensurate with level of experience Opportunities for career advancement
